Factors Influencing Cost
Residential roof replacement in Granby, CT, involves removing the existing roofing material and installing a new roof to protect the home from weather elements. Understanding the typical scope and considerations can help homeowners plan and compare options effectively.
- Materials: Common options include asphalt shingles, metal roofing, or wood shakes, each with different durability and aesthetic qualities.
- Size and Scope: The project size depends on the roof's square footage, pitch, and complexity, influencing overall effort and materials needed.
- Labor Complexity: Roofs with multiple levels, intricate designs, or difficult access may require more specialized labor, affecting costs and duration.
- Permitting: Local permits are typically required in Granby, CT, to ensure compliance with building codes and safety standards.
- Additional Features: Options such as ventilation upgrades, flashing repairs, or insulation enhancements can be included as part of the replacement process.
Project Size & Scope
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Single-story home (up to 1,500 sq ft) | $8,000 - $15,000 |
| Two-story home (1,500-3,000 sq ft) | $15,000 - $30,000 |
| Complex roof design (e.g., multiple peaks) | $20,000 - $40,000 |
| Additional features (skylights, chimneys) | Varies, typically $1,000 - $3,000 each |
| Roof removal and disposal | Included in total; varies with size |
In Granby, CT, residential roof replacement costs can vary based on roof size, design complexity, and additional features.
